What are the four symptoms of Diabetes mellitus?

1. Hyperglycemia- presence of excess of glucose level in the blood.

2. Thirst- due to loss of fluid there will be increased thirst to replenish the lost water.

3. Frequent urination- urine is produced in large quantities and very fre­quently there is urge for urination. This condition is called polyuria.

4. Presence of sugar in urine- excess quantities of sugar are excreted through the urine, hence the name sweet urine. This condition is called glycosuria.

Or

5. In some cases there is increased hunger.

6. Excessive production of ketone bodies(acetone, acetoacetic acid) will result due to disturbance in fat metabolism. Sometimes patients develop acidosis due to the production of acetoacetic acid.

7. Nocturia- usually patients get up in the night for urination.

8. Excessive tiredness is experienced.

9. Wound healing is normally delayed.
